I've noticed quite a few manual screenshots being made of MLV. I have simplified this by incorporating it into MLV. To create a screenshot of just the graph section you are currently looking at:
On the Menubar select "File-->Save Graph as PNG or Jpeg"
That simple:
The default format will be PNG if you are running on JRE 1.4 or newer, jpeg is all that is available on anything older.
The reason I have selected PNG as the default, for limited color images like a graph (compared to a photo) it will compress smaller and have NO LOSS of color or quality. Jpeg, while great for high color count photos looses a great deal of color and quality. The image will become blurred and less brilliant with Jpeg. That is just the way the jpeg compression algorithm works, it works much better than png for photos, but for graphs, png (or GIF) is far superior.
